博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
9. configparser 设置配置文件模块
阅读量:4585 次
发布时间:2019-06-09

本文共 633 字,大约阅读时间需要 2 分钟。

1) configparser

读取配置文件内容,增、删、改、查等等操作

2) configparser 常用命令

配置文件内容如下[section1]k1 = v1k2:v2user=egonage=18is_admin=truesalary=31[section2]k1 = v1

import configparserconfig = configparser.ConfigParser()#一次性读取该配置文件的所有内容config.read('mi.ini')#取某个标题([section1])下的某个配置变量print(config.get('section1','k2'))  #v2#判断是否有该配置变量print(config.has_option('section2','k2'))   #False#往已有配置文件种增加配置变量config.add_section('egon')config.set('egon','name','egon')config.set('egon','age','18')   #不可以是数字,只能是字符串#新增变量后,写入到文件中,这里可以重命名,因为之前config.read(),已经把配置文件的内容全部读入了config.write(open('mi.ini','w',encoding='utf-8'))

转载于:https://www.cnblogs.com/liaor/p/8284951.html

你可能感兴趣的文章
科技创新平台年报系统利益相关者分析
查看>>
家庭作业第三章3.57
查看>>
ERROR! MySQL manager or server PID file could not be found!
查看>>
nginx server_name匹配顺序
查看>>
数据备份希望使用gistore备份mongo数据
查看>>
【杂谈】新学年的第一篇博客
查看>>
MySQL性能优化的21条最佳经验【转】
查看>>
关于udo3d双目相机的嵌入式板子系统重装
查看>>
nginx安装缺少依赖记录
查看>>
vcs编译verilog/sysverilog并执行
查看>>
Mvc 提交表单的4种方法全程详解
查看>>
质因数分解
查看>>
2015年4月30日
查看>>
《Intel汇编第5版》 条件汇编伪指令
查看>>
mybatis如何根据mapper接口生成其实现类(springboot)
查看>>
K8S集群技术
查看>>
Failed to load resource: the server responded with a status of 404 (Not Found) favicon.ico文件找不到...
查看>>
Linux基础命令小结
查看>>
黑马程序员--抽象类与接口
查看>>
IaaS,PaaS,SaaS 的区别
查看>>